Blended 2.0 shifts learning in schools

Blended 2.0 shifts learning in schools | Information and digital literacy in education via the digital path | Scoop.it
The tech-powered combination of face-to-face classroom instruction with online inquiry that students pursue on their own has progressed into a new phase. But what constitutes blended learning 2.0 varies widely across districts.

The Class: Living and Learning in the Digital Age - DML Hub

The Class: Living and Learning in the Digital Age - DML Hub | Information and digital literacy in education via the digital path | Scoop.it
Based upon fieldwork at an ordinary London school, The Class examines young people’s experiences of growing up and learning in a digital world. In this original and engaging study, Sonia Livingstone and Julian Sefton-Green explore youth values, teenagers’ perspectives on their futures, and their tactics for facing the opportunities and challenges that lie ahead.
